How can I get to Ponte Milvio?
With so many transport options, seeing the area around Ponte Milvio is easy. Head to Vigna Clara Station for metro transport. To explore the surrounding area, ride one of the trains from Rome Tor di Quinto Station or Rome Due Ponti Station.
